Here's my opinion on the both. You can bring a friend, but it's possible that they guy you've been eyeing says "no" to you and "yes" to your friend, which is awkward. Of course, he could also say "yes" to the both of you - and then a "discussion" ensues about who's gonna go out with him. Again, awkward. :ohwell:

To the second question.... The one I went to was speed dating and then like a happy hour afterwards. My friends both made a mutual match with each other, but after speed dating, they just took it over to the bar and started talking. Before the night was over they exchanged numbers and it's been history ever since. Usually, though, the organizers will email you the the results and contact information of any mutual matches (you both marked "yes" to each other) within a day or two.
